A well-established secondary school in Guildford, Surrey is looking for an experienced Finance Manager to join its business support team from September 2026. This is a hands-on role with responsibility for the day-to-day management of the school's finances, alongside supporting senior leaders with budgeting, forecasting and longer-term financial planning. It's a good opportunity for an experienced finance professional who enjoys working independently, takes pride in accuracy and wants to use their skills in an education setting.
The Role
- Managing the school's day-to-day finance function
- Preparing budgets, forecasts and regular financial reports
- Monitoring expenditure and investigating variances
- Processing and overseeing invoices, purchase orders and payments
- Completing bank and financial reconciliations
- Supporting payroll and pension administration
- Managing supplier accounts and procurement processes
- Preparing financial information for audits and reporting
- Working with budget holders across the school
- Identifying opportunities to improve financial processes and value for money
- Providing financial information and advice to senior leaders
About You
The successful candidate will have solid experience in finance, accounting or financial management, with the confidence to take ownership of a busy finance function. Previous experience within a school, academy or other education setting would be advantageous, but relevant experience from the commercial, charity or public sectors will also be considered. You'll be highly organised, numerate and comfortable working with confidential information. Strong Excel skills and excellent attention to detail are essential, along with the ability to communicate financial information clearly to non-finance colleagues.
